Characteristics of White Iceberg Shrub Rose as a Perennial
Key Features ๐น
The White Iceberg Shrub Rose is classified as a hardy perennial, making it a resilient choice for any garden. With proper care, these beauties can thrive for 10-15 years or even longer.
Their multi-year lifecycle ensures consistent regrowth each year, providing a reliable burst of color. Throughout the growing season, expect a prolific display of stunning white flowers that can brighten up any landscape.
This rose variety not only offers aesthetic appeal but also contributes to a vibrant garden ecosystem. Its ability to bloom continuously encourages pollinators, making it a favorite among gardeners who appreciate both beauty and biodiversity.
In summary, the White Iceberg Shrub Rose stands out for its longevity, consistent growth, and abundant flowering. These characteristics make it a valuable addition to any perennial garden, ensuring that your outdoor space remains lively year after year.

Climate Zone Variations
๐ Variations in Behavior Across Different Climates
The White Iceberg Shrub Rose is remarkably adaptable, thriving in a variety of climate zones. Whether you're in a temperate region or a warmer area, this perennial can flourish, though its performance may vary based on local conditions.
๐ฑ Influence of Growing Conditions
Several factors influence the growth of the White Iceberg Shrub Rose. Key elements include temperature, humidity, and soil type, all of which play a crucial role in its health and blooming potential.
Temperature
The ideal temperature range for growth is between 60ยฐF to 75ยฐF. Extreme heat or cold can stress the plant, affecting its blooming cycle.
Humidity
Moderate humidity levels are best. Too much moisture can lead to fungal diseases, while too little can hinder growth.
Soil Type
Well-draining soil enriched with organic matter promotes robust growth. Sandy loam is often ideal, but the rose can adapt to various soil types with proper care.
๐ Recommendations for Optimal Growth in Diverse Climates
To maximize the health of your White Iceberg Shrub Rose, consider these tips:
- Soil Preparation: Amend soil with compost to improve drainage and nutrient content.
- Watering Practices: Ensure consistent moisture, especially during dry spells, but avoid waterlogging.
- Mulching: Apply mulch to retain moisture and regulate soil temperature.

Maximizing Benefits in Garden Planning
Tips for Long-Term Cultivation ๐ฑ
To ensure your White Iceberg Shrub Rose thrives, start with proper soil preparation. Well-draining soil enriched with organic matter sets the stage for healthy growth.
Fertilization is key to robust blooms. Use a balanced fertilizer during the growing season to provide essential nutrients.
Pruning is another vital practice. Regularly trim dead or spent blooms to encourage new growth and maintain the plant's shape.
Strategies for Garden Design ๐จ
Companion planting can enhance the health of your shrub rose. Pair it with plants that deter pests or attract beneficial insects.
Design your garden for maximum visual impact. Group your roses in clusters to create a stunning display that draws the eye.
Consider seasonal interest when planning your garden layout. Incorporate plants that bloom at different times to ensure color and vibrancy throughout the year.
